Overview

Alkandstrand is Richards Bay's ocean beach, on the KwaZulu-Natal north coast. This sandy beach offers open-sea kite conditions with warm tropical waters (22-26°C). Ocean alternative to the flat-water spot at Pelican Island. Suitable for intermediate riders.

Technical details of Alkandstrand spot

Spot functioning map

Spot functioning

The spot works in NE to SE winds. Sandy beach exposed to swell. Best at mid-tide. Less sheltered than Pelican Island in the bay.

On the water

Warm tropical water (22-26°C). Sandy bottom. Regular waves. Moderate coastal currents.

Required level

Intermediate

Spot opening date

Open all year round

Spot currently open :-)

Parking

Access from Richards Bay. Beachside parking. Richards Bay urban infrastructure nearby.

Hazards

Shore break. Coastal currents. Sharks present (bull sharks and Zambezi sharks). Jellyfish in summer. Solo sailing not recommended.

Wind specificities

The dominant wind is the NE (summer trade wind), blowing side-onshore. Reliable thermal wind in the afternoon. Year-round, best October to April.
